Hello all, I just found something new and had to share. Lots of people and experts have suggested using Browsie Browser numerous times and I had insisted that FireFox worked best for some sites. Well with the default settings that bay be true but today I dug deeper into Browsie Browser and discovered why it was recommended so.
Browsie Browser
If you go into settings / Display and Actions / User Agent you will get to choose you Desktop User Agent. I chose FireFox and it works excellent for sites like Google+ and such.
I don't know why people who have suggested Browsie did not mention why or how to configure. No one would think initially to try this without a mention. Anyway I hope this helps many to enjoy quicker browsing on their BB10 devices.
